mirror of https://github.com/moparisthebest/curl
Check that all servers in the <server> section are supported, not just
the first.
This commit is contained in:
parent
f9cfef3599
commit
3f55ed0ef7
|
@ -2376,13 +2376,15 @@ sub serverfortest {
|
||||||
return "no server specified";
|
return "no server specified";
|
||||||
}
|
}
|
||||||
|
|
||||||
my $proto = lc($what[0]);
|
for (@what) {
|
||||||
|
my $proto = lc($_);
|
||||||
chomp $proto;
|
chomp $proto;
|
||||||
if (! grep /^$proto$/, @protocols) {
|
if (! grep /^$proto$/, @protocols) {
|
||||||
if (substr($proto,0,5) ne "socks") {
|
if (substr($proto,0,5) ne "socks") {
|
||||||
return "curl lacks any $proto support";
|
return "curl lacks any $proto support";
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
}
|
||||||
|
|
||||||
return &startservers(@what);
|
return &startservers(@what);
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ue